You can create a Study tree by importing external PGN file into a New Chapter in Chess Forge. To do this, go to the Chapters list (green below) and use the right-click context menu to select Import Chapter (red below):

 

In the dialog box, select the PGN file you want to import (green below) and open it (red below):

 

Depending on what type of PGN file is selected, the system opens one of the following dialogs:

Chapters dialog

Opens if the selected file is a Chess Forge Workbook. All chapters in the file are listed, and you can select the ones to import into your workbook using the checkboxes on the left side of the window (red below). In our example, we select the chapter King's Gambit Declined (green below):

 

New chapter was imported (green below) with the study (blue below) and 5 games (purple below):

 

Click on the Study tree (blue above) to open the Study view (blue below):

Import from PGN dialog

Opens if the selected file is not a Chess Forge Workbook. All Games and Exercises found in the file are listed and you can select those you want to import into your workbook using tick boxes on the left hand side of the window (red below):

 

New Chapter was created (green below) from all selected games (blue below):

 

If needed, you can automatically generate the Study tree from the imported games. For more details see Regenerating Study from Games section.
